LCD Screen Production

The production of LCD screens involves several stages, including mining and refining raw materials, manufacturing the display components, and assembly. Each stage has its own environmental impacts, which can be broadly categorized into two areas: resource depletion and pollution.

Resource Depletion

The production of LCD screens requires the extraction and processing of several raw materials, including lithium, copper, aluminum, and rare earth metals. These materials are often extracted using methods that can have negative environmental impacts, such as open-pit mining and chemical processing. Additionally, the demand for these materials has led to increased competition for limited resources, which can contribute to their depletion.

Pollution

The manufacturing process for LCD screens involves the use of several chemicals, including solvents, acids, and bases. These chemicals can be toxic and can contaminate the air, water, and soil if not properly managed. Additionally, the production of LCD screens generates a significant amount of waste, including electronic waste (e-waste), which can contain hazardous materials that can leach into the environment if not disposed of properly.

LCD Screen Disposal

Once an LCD screen reaches the end of its lifespan, it must be disposed of properly. Unfortunately, many consumers and businesses do not follow proper disposal procedures, which can lead to environmental harm. There are several ways in which improper LCD screen disposal can impact the environment:

Hazardous Waste Contamination

When LCD screens are disposed of improperly, they can release hazardous materials into the environment. For example, when e-waste is incinerated or landfilled without proper treatment, it can release toxic chemicals into the air and soil. This can have negative impacts on human health and the environment.

Resource Depletion

Improper disposal of LCD screens can also contribute to resource depletion. When e-waste is sent to developing countries for recycling, there is no guarantee that the materials will be properly processed or that the resulting products will be used sustainably. Additionally, some e-waste is simply discarded in landfills, where it can take hundreds of years to decompose and release its harmful chemicals into the environment.

Environmental Impact Mitigation Strategies

While the environmental impacts of LCD screen production and disposal are significant, there are several strategies that can be employed to mitigate these impacts:

Sustainable Mining Practices

To reduce the environmental impact of mining and refining raw materials for LCD screen production, companies can adopt sustainable mining practices that minimize habitat destruction and water pollution. Additionally, companies can work to reduce their reliance on rare earth metals by developing alternative technologies that do not require these materials.

Proper Waste Management

To reduce the environmental impact of LCD screen disposal, companies can implement proper waste management practices that ensure hazardous materials are contained and treated appropriately. Additionally, consumers can be educated on proper disposal procedures and encouraged to recycle their old LCD screens.
